Mahua has a shiny and golden look. It is made by frying a bar of dough in peanut oil.
The bars are usually stuffed with a variety of fillings, most often waxy tasting beanpaste (Dou sha), a taste only for the hardy.
Since it can be preserved for several months, you can take it home to share with your family and friends.
